Let's start with one of the favorites of the tournament - the Netherlands team. The European representatives in Group A will face Senegal, Ecuador, and the tournament hosts Qatar. The Achievements of the National Team: in recent years, the Dutch national team has experienced a difficult period, failing to qualify for two tournaments (the 2016 European Championship and the 2018 World Cup). The "OnsOranje" broke the championship drought in 2020 when they participated in the European Football Championship. The tournament was not successful for the team. In the round of 16, the Netherlands lost 0-2 to the Czech Republic. An interesting fact about this team is that the Netherlands has reached the World Cup final more times than any other team but has never won it. In 1974, they lost in the final to West Germany, in 1978 they were defeated by Argentina, and in 2010 after extra time, they had to acknowledge Spain's superiority. In 2014, the Netherlands managed to win the third place in the World Cup, by defeating the tournament host Brazil 3-0 in the small final. One of the team's major achievements is winning the UEFA European Championship trophy in 1988. In the final, the Netherlands beat the Soviet Union team 2-0. Looking back at the beginning of the 20th century, the "Oranje" also won three bronze medals in the Olympic Games (1908, 1912, 1920). The Leaders of the National Team: in this tournament, the backbone of the Dutch national team will be the central defenders. The captain of the team, Virgil Van Dijk, and the newcomer from Munich "Bayern," Matthijs de Ligt. The team composition will not change significantly from the 2020 European Championship. In the midfield, Frankie de Jong will continue to play, and we will also see the newcomer from "Bayern," Ryan Gravenberch. The attacking leader will continue to be Memphis Depay, who plays for "Barcelona." Alongside him will be Dortmund's player, Donyell Malen, and Steven Bergwijn, who plays for "Ajax." The Team's Coach: since 2021, Louis van Gaal has returned as the head coach of the Dutch national football team. The 71-year-old strategist stands at the helm of the Netherlands team for the third time. The first time was in 2000-2001, and the second time was in 2012-2014. Van Gaal's biggest achievement in the team's coaching history was the third place at the 2014 World Cup. In this tournament, the coach stood out with a memorable moment when in the quarterfinals against Costa Rica, he replaced the main goalkeeper Jasper Cillessen with Tim Krul in the penalty shootout. Krul saved two penalties, leading the Netherlands team to the World Cup semifinals. After the championship, Van Gaal took over as the coach of "Manchester United." However, this period was not successful for the coach, and after two years, the club parted ways with Van Gaal in 2016. Since then, Van Gaal did not coach any teams until he returned to coach the national team in 2021.
